The Boyajians Get Involved

"We're retired, we have a little time now, and we thought the best place to direct our energies would be St. Nersess, because that's where our future priests are coming from, and that's where our young people are going to rediscover their Armenian roots and their Christian faith," Sarkis Boyajian.

Armenians share their time, treasure, and talents with their fellow parishioners and the Diocese in all sorts of ways.  But Sarkis and Alice Boyajian from Sts. Joachim and Anne Armenian Church in Palos Heights, Illinois set an example that few of us can match.

Several times a year they drive 800 miles from Palos Heights to St. Nersess Seminary.  Their SUV is laden with tools, hardware, cabinets, food and inexhaustible stores of energy and love.  They unload and immediately begin painting, wiring, plastering, renovating, building, cooking, and organizing--accepting not a penny in return.  They see this as their way to give back to a seminary that gave so much to them and their children.

No one asked them to do this.  They saw a need and an opportunity.  They rolled up their sleeves, got to work, and have blessed many people.
